Mon site Web contient tout le contenu sur une seule page. J'utilise JavaScript pour faire glisser (animer) entre les différentes "sous-pages", de sorte que seul le contenu de la sous-page est affiché.
Les boutons de menu sont comme ceci: <a href="#welcome">Welcome</a>
avec un return false
.
En ce qui concerne Google, les autres robots et le référencement, serait-il préférable d'utiliser rel="nofollow"
sur ces liens de menu?
Je veux dire, les liens de menu ne pointent sur rien, seulement en visionnant avec un navigateur
Nofollow
ne va pas changer la façon dont les moteurs de recherche traitent ces liens.
javascript:
) à votre serveur. La présence ou l'absence de nofollow
ne changera rien à cela.nofollow
pour empêcher le passage de PageRank. Dans le pire des cas, l'ajout d'un nofollow
pourrait entraîner la suppression d'une partie de votre PageRank alors qu'elle ne l'était pas auparavant.nofollow
pour indiquer que les liens ont été placés par les utilisateurs.Je ne vois pas comment nofollow
pourrait aider. Il serait probablement simplement ignoré, mais dans le pire des cas, cela pourrait faire mal.
Google dit l'attribut rel="nofollow"
sur les liens ne doit être utilisé que pour les liens que le webmaster ne contrôle pas l'insertion sur les pages (donc, en général, utile pour les commentaires des utilisateurs qui mettent des liens vers leurs sites. ..).
Dans votre cas, vous insérez vous-même ces liens pour aider les utilisateurs à naviguer. C'est pourquoi vous devez éviter l'attribut rel="nofollow"
sur les liens.
De plus, contrairement à ce que vous dites, ces liens pointent vers des sous-sections de vos pages, en JavaScript mais ils renvoient à quelque chose.
Seuls les liens sortants (internes ou externes) sont impliqués dans le calcul du classement PageRank.
En fait, les ancres nommées dans les pages peuvent aider votre référencement en construisant des liens nommés dans SERP. Regardez ici .
Pour l'attribut rel="nofollow"
:
Rel="nofollow"
devrait pas être utilisé pour le modelage du PageRank. Lorsque vous ajouteznofollow
à un lien, comme dans votre exemple, vous indiquez en fait aux moteurs de recherche que ce lien ne peut pas être approuvé.
Rel="nofollow"
n'exclut pas un lien du calcul du PageRank, mais il dit seulement aux bots de ne pas suivre ce lien et de ne pas transmettre anchortext.
Par exemple, sur une page, vous avez 10 liens (interne externe, il n'y a pas de différence), et disons qu'il existe 50 jus PageRank pour cette page.
Pour calculer la quantité de jus que chaque lien reçoit, nous devons diviser le jus total par le nombre total de liens, dans cet exemple 50/10 = 5 jus par lien.
Si tous les liens sont suivis, tous vos liens auront 5 jus. Si vous n'en suivez pas 2, le total des pertes obtenues par chaque lien n'est pas modifié. Donc, vous aurez 8 liens avec 5 jus et 2 liens avec 0 jus.
Ce n’est pas le cas: 50/(total des liens - nofollowed) = 50/8 = 6,25 jus par lien.
En résumé, lorsque vous ne suivez pas un lien, il ne le supprime pas du calcul du PageRank.
Vous pouvez trouver plus d'informations ici .